The Caldarian Conflict

ebook
Brother Mendell isn't someone you'd expect to see helping a pirate. After all, he's a monk who follows a god named Lord Justice, and pirates certainly deserve punishment. As a corrupt military deals death to pirates using questionable methods, Mendell finds himself caught in the crossfire when he seeks justice for an unfairly executed prisoner. No one is safe as Admiral Cain and his ruthless assistant Krell struggle to maintain complete secrecy over their plan. Their goal isn't merely to rid Caldaria of pirates; they have much loftier ambitions. Anyone with too much knowledge must die. Mendell struggles to unravel the mystery before he, too, becomes a casualty of The Caldarian Conflict. Back Cover Text: “Pirates are a disease,” Admiral Cain often growls. He’ll stop at nothing to eradicate them from the realm of Caldaria. Luckily, Cain and his assistant Krell have devised a seemingly perfect solution. There’s a catch: if the Caldarian citizens discover their methods, the peasants will revolt. If King Lothar uncovers the truth, Admiral Cain will lose his head. Brother Mendell, a monk dedicated to Lord Justice, is sucked into the web of deceit when he consoles a pirate prisoner sentenced for execution. In his quest for justice, Mendell inadvertently finds himself at the forefront of a raging war between pirates and the Caldarian navy. Even the gods themselves have taken sides. In order to bring the scales back into balance, Mendell must navigate deadly seas, survive traitorous pirates, and outsmart the devious admiral and his ruthless assistant. If the monk fails, the freedom of an entire nation lies at stake.
